The Importance of Gutters & Downspouts: Preventing Water Damage

June 27, 2024

Safeguarding Your Home's Foundation and Structure

Gutters and downspouts are often overlooked components of a home's exterior, but they play a crucial role in protecting its structural integrity and preventing water damage. Let's discuss the importance of gutters and downspouts in channeling rainwater away from your home, and preserving its foundation, siding, and landscaping.


Preventing Water Damage:

  1. Foundation Protection: Properly functioning gutters and downspouts direct rainwater away from the foundation of your home, preventing soil erosion and minimizing the risk of foundation damage. Without adequate drainage, excess water can seep into the soil around your home, causing it to expand and contract, leading to cracks and structural instability.
  2. Siding Preservation: Water runoff from roofs can damage siding materials, such as wood, vinyl, or stucco, leading to rot, mold, and discoloration. Gutters collect rainwater as it cascades off the roof and direct it away from the exterior walls, preserving the appearance and integrity of your home's siding.


Preventing Basement Flooding:

  1. Eaves Protection: Without gutters, water can drip directly off the roof eaves, saturating the ground around your home's perimeter and increasing the likelihood of basement flooding. Gutters catch this runoff and channel it into downspouts, directing it safely away from your home's foundation and basement windows.
  2. Landscaping Preservation: Excessive water runoff can wreak havoc on your landscaping, causing soil erosion, plant damage, and waterlogged areas in your yard. By collecting rainwater and directing it away from your home's foundation, gutters and downspouts help preserve the health and appearance of your landscaping.


Maintenance and Care:

  1. Regular Cleaning: To ensure optimal performance, gutters and downspouts should be cleaned regularly to remove leaves, debris, and other obstructions that can impede water flow. Neglecting gutter maintenance can lead to clogs, overflow, and water damage to your home's exterior and interior.
  2. Inspection and Repair: Periodically inspect your gutters and downspouts for signs of damage, such as sagging, rust, or leaks. Addressing issues promptly can prevent further damage and prolong the lifespan of your gutter system.


Gutters and downspouts are essential components of your home's exterior, serving to protect its foundation, siding, and landscaping from water damage. By ensuring proper installation, maintenance, and care, you can safeguard your home against the costly effects of water intrusion and preserve its structural integrity for years to come.
